Gangatikuri is a village in Ketugram II CD Block in Katwa subdivision of Purba Bardhaman district in the state of West Bengal, India.

Demographics

As per the 2011 Census of India Gangatikuri had a total population of 4,053, of which 2,064 (51%) were males and 1,989 (49%) were females. Population below 6 years was 476. The total number of literates in Gangatikuri was 2,067 (57.79% of the population over 6 years).[1]

Transport

Gangatikuri is a station on the Barharwa-Azimganj-Katwa loop Gangatikuri is on the way of Uddhanpur-Bolpur/ Suri Road .[2]
